Check for Experience with Truck Accident Litigation
Now, you may think that it is enough for you to just find a personal injury attorney and be done with it. This, however, is not the case, given that personal injury law definitely covers many different types of cases, and while some attorneys may be primarily focused on, say, slip and fall accidents or general car collisions, others may be more experienced in representing victims that have been injured in truck crashes. So, what you have to do here is check if the prospective attorneys have experience when it comes to truck accident litigation specifically, and only choose those that do.
Inquire About the Investigation Process
Moving on, you have to understand that a strong truck accident claim is sure to begin with thorough investigation. This, of course, means that you should ask those potential attorneys how it is that they typically handle the investigation process when it comes to these crashes. Their approach can include things like reviewing police reports, visiting the accident scene, obtaining trucking company records, interviewing witnesses, examining vehicle damage, and reviewing medical documentation, as well as potentially working with accident reconstruction experts. Your goal here is to check the investigation process, keeping in mind that comprehensive investigation can surely strengthen both settlement negotiations and courtroom presentations.
Check for Trial Experience
Speaking of courtrooms, you should also remember to check the trial experience of the professionals you have in mind. Sure, most cases like these will settle out of court, but some may require litigation. Furthermore, those insurance companies will surely be willing to negotiate much more fairly if they know that your attorney has courtroom experience. So, don’t forget to inquire about this and always choose an attorney that will be prepared to go to trial if that winds up being necessary.

Talk About the Fees
Apart from all of the above, you should also remember to discuss the fees with the potential candidates you have in mind. You want to know how it is that they charge for their services, as well as what it is that is included in the fees, and whether you should expect some additional costs throughout the process. So, talk about this with the potential candidates, and make sure that you clearly understand the fee agreement, as that will help prevent some misunderstandings and unpleasant financial surprises later on.
